Today’s #microbe:
- it a virus
- the most common cause of gastroenteritis
- results in about 685 million cases a year
- single stranded
- belong to the Caliciviridae family
- can be classified into 5 genotroups
- are non-enveloped
- have linear and non-segmented RNA genome
- replication is cytoplasmic
- replicates through positive stranded RNA virus transcription
- replicates in the small intestine of the host
- commonly diagnosed by polymerase chain reaction assays
